How should the suicide (commando) attacks in Palestine be evaluated according to our religion? Is a suicide attack permissible in our religion?

The Answer

Dear Brother / Sister,

As you know, when Muslims die for their religion, life, property and progeny, they are regarded as martyrs.

There are hadiths stating that those who die for their religion, property and life will be martyrs.

As for the events in Palestine, which are discussed a lot in the Islamic world, are they regarded as suicide or martyrdom? We see that there are two different understandings: suicide and not suicide. Our opinion and conclusion are as follows:

1. Since we do not know the inner world and intentions of people and we are to have good thoughts about people, when we consider that they sacrifice themselves for the sake of their religion and homeland, it is understood that their deed is not suicide but martyrdom.

2. According to our religion, one of the conditions of war is this rule: “War can only be fought against those who fight and those who participate in the war.”

When we have a look at the events in Palestine, we see that this rule is sometimes violated. Non-combatants as well as children and women are also attacked. What is more, such a deed can even lead to the perception that Islam is a religion of terrorism and that they kill innocent people including women and children.

So, sacrificing oneself for one’s religion and homeland is good. However, according to our religion, it is also necessary to do it against those who participate in the war. It is not appropriate to do it against innocent people. Therefore, we find it appropriate to make such an evaluation instead of making a final decision. Allah knows best.
